Browser-based interactive tutorial for Sitecore PowerShell Extensions (SPE). Embedded in doc.sitecorepowershell.com via iframe. Built with Bun + Vite + React 19 + TypeScript (strict). Deployed to Cloudflare Pages.

The codebase has two independent layers: a pure TypeScript simulation engine (src/engine/) with zero React dependencies, and a React UI (src/components/). The engine is fully testable in isolation.
executor.ts — Core pipeline executor. Dispatches parsed commands to ~20 cmdlet handlers (Get-Item, Get-ChildItem, Where-Object, ForEach-Object, Select-Object, Sort-Object, etc.) via a switch/case on cmdlet name. Supports aliases (gci, ls, dir, ?, where, select, etc.) through ALIAS_MAP. Handles multi-line scripts with executeScript(), including if/else, foreach loops, and variable assignments.
virtualTree.ts — Simulated Sitecore content tree as a deep nested object. Each node has _id, _template, _templateFullName, _version, _fields, _children. Use createVirtualTree() to get a deep clone for test isolation — never mutate the shared VIRTUAL_TREE in tests.
expressionEval.ts — Centralized expression evaluator handling: literals, variables ($_, $varName), operators (-eq, -like, -match, -replace, -split, -join, -f), .NET static calls ([DateTime]::Now, [Math]::Round()), type casts, and property chaining.
filterEval.ts — Boolean filter evaluator for Where-Object conditions. Supports compound expressions with -and, -or, -not. Delegates to evaluateExpression() for individual comparisons.
parser.ts — Tokenizer that splits on | at the top level while respecting quotes and {} braces. Returns both raw strings (needed for Where-Object/ForEach-Object brace extraction) and parsed stages.
properties.ts — getItemProperty(item, prop) is the single source of truth for all property access. Case-insensitive lookup with fallback chain: builtins → case-sensitive fields → case-insensitive fields → empty string. Always returns strings.
pathResolver.ts — Resolves PowerShell-style paths (master:\content\Home) to tree node references.
scriptContext.ts — ScriptContext holds variable scope across multi-line scripts. Auto-unwraps single-element arrays on assignment (PowerShell behavior).
validator.ts — Three modes: structural (checks cmdlet presence, parameters, switches without executing), pipeline (checks stage presence + optionally executes for output), and output (executes script and checks output strings only). Validates resolved paths, not raw strings, so aliases and path variations work correctly.
23 YAML files loaded via loader.ts using js-yaml with Vite ?raw imports. Each lesson has id, module, title, difficulty, mode (repl/ise), description (markdown), and tasks[] with instruction, hint, starterCode, and validation spec.
ExecutionProvider interface abstracts where commands execute. App.tsx delegates all execution through the active provider.
LocalProvider — wraps the existing engine and virtual tree. Default for tutorials. Exposes getContext() and getFullTree() for validation.
SpeRemotingProvider — sends scripts to a real Sitecore instance via speClient.ts (/-/script/script/ endpoint). Uses JWT or Basic auth. Scripts are wrapped in & { <script> } | Out-String so PowerShell's ps1xml formatting rules apply server-side. Tree panel falls back to virtual tree (SPE Remoting has no tree browsing API). Supports optional CORS proxy (useProxy/proxyUrl in ConnectionConfig).
ConnectionManager component in the header lets users toggle between local simulation and a live Sitecore connection. URL, username, and proxy preferences persist to localStorage; credentials are never stored. Includes a "Use CORS proxy" checkbox for instances that block cross-origin requests.
cors-proxy.ts — Local Bun server that forwards requests to a Sitecore instance and adds CORS headers. Runs on the user's machine, so it can reach internal/VPN-only instances. Usage: bun run cors-proxy -- --target https://sitecore.example.com. The user enters http://localhost:3001 as the proxy URL in ConnectionManager.
App.tsx is the root component holding all state. Key components: Sidebar (lesson navigation), LessonPanel (instructions + TreePanel in tabs), ReplEditor (console with autocomplete/history), IseEditor (multi-line editor), OutputPane (result formatting), ConnectionManager (live instance toggle). Session progress and UI preferences persist to localStorage.

Tests live in __tests__/ directories adjacent to source. Use describe/it/expect/beforeEach pattern. Every test that touches the tree should call createVirtualTree() in beforeEach. Engine tests import directly from engine modules — no React rendering needed.
